The Wideband Switching capability supports end-to-end connectivity between
customer endpoints at data rates from 128 to 1536 kbps over T1 facilities and to
1984 kbps over E1 facilities. Avaya DEFINITY Server switching capabilities are
extended to support wideband calls comprised of multiple DS0s that are switched
end-to-end as a single entity.
The Wideband Switching capability extends the Administered Connections
feature to include non-signaling Wideband Access Endpoints. Endpoint
application equipment with direct T1 or E1 interfaces may connect directly to the
switch's line-side facilities. Application equipment without T1 or E1 interfaces
requires a Terminal Adapter, such as a DSU/CSU. The terminal adapter or
endpoint application equipment is connected to the Universal DS1 circuit pack
(TN464C). These endpoints are administered as Access Endpoints, and they
have no signaling interface to the switch. Instead, they simply transmit and
receive data. (Some applications detect and respond to the presence or absence
of data.) Calls are initiated from these endpoints using the Administered
Connections feature.
Multiple Access Endpoints on one line-side UDS1 circuit pack (TN464C) facility
are separate and distinct within the facility, and the endpoint application
equipment must be administered to send and receive the correct data rate over
the correct DS0s. All Administered Connections originating from Access
Endpoints use the entire bandwidth administered for the Access Endpoint. An
incoming call of a different data rate then that administered for the Access
Endpoint cannot be routed to the Access Endpoint.
